What Sets UK Online Casinos Apart?
Unlike the wild west of some international markets, UK online casinos operate under stringent regulations enforced by the UK Gambling Commission. This means players enjoy a level of protection that’s often taken for granted. However, the flip side is that operators must jump through hoops that can sometimes stifle innovation or lead to a homogenized experience.
Still, the UK market is a playground for both classic casino fans and those chasing the latest tech-driven gaming trends. From virtual slots to live dealer tables, the variety is staggering, but not all that glitters is gold.
Licensing and Security: The Backbone of Trust
Trust isn’t handed out like free spins; it’s earned through transparency and security. UK casinos must demonstrate robust measures to protect player data and ensure fair play. This includes independent audits and clear terms and conditions that don’t read like a novel in legalese.
Players should always verify licensing details before committing funds. A quick check on the UK Gambling Commission’s website can save a lot of headaches down the line.

Payment Methods: Navigating the Maze
Depositing and withdrawing funds can sometimes feel like a game of its own. UK casinos generally support a range of payment options, but the speed and fees involved can be a gamble.
| Payment Method | Deposit Speed | Withdrawal Speed | Typical Fees |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Debit/Credit Cards | Instant | 1-3 Business Days | Usually Free | Widely accepted, but some banks block gambling transactions |
| E-Wallets (PayPal, Skrill) | Instant | Within 24 Hours | Sometimes fees apply | Fast withdrawals, popular among frequent players |
| Bank Transfers | 1-3 Business Days | 3-5 Business Days | Varies | Less convenient, but reliable for large sums |
| Prepaid Cards (Paysafecard) | Instant | Not available for withdrawals | Usually Free | Good for budgeting, but limited flexibility |

Responsible Gambling: A Necessary Conversation
It’s tempting to think of online casinos as harmless fun, but the reality can be more complicated. The UK market has taken strides in promoting responsible gambling, with tools like deposit limits, self-exclusion, and reality checks becoming standard.
Players should approach gambling with a clear head and a strict budget. After all, the house always has an edge, and chasing losses is a fast track to disappointment.
